What is Trojan.Backdoor-JCK?

Trojan.Backdoor-JCK has come out recently and attacked numerous computers all around the world in a very short period. Usually it could be reported by some excellent antivirus such as MSE but can never be deleted completely. What we should know about the bug is that it’s good at exploiting security vulnerabilities and changing its characteristics all the time via rootkit technology. Its infiltration is often undertaken without asking any permission of victims. If you’re fond of downloading “free” application from unknown resource, visiting hacked websites, or opening spam email messages, it’s most probable that your machine gets contracted with the pest.

When Trojan.Backdoor-JCK slips into your PC, it would use every resource on compromised machine to make mess there. For instance, it may consume a large amount of system resource to slow down the performance of Windows, and no wonder you may even suffer from abnormal shutdown issues or system crash issues randomly. Besides, Trojan.Backdoor-JCK has the ability to download and execute arbitrary files like rogueware or ransomware onto your system to damage it further. It’s crystal clear that the more threats the more dangerous your system will be.

Moreover, Trojan.Backdoor-JCK can also trigger the redirect issues to interfere with your browsing activities. It’s able to make some modifications in browsers like IE, Firefox and Chrome to redirect you to some harmful websites. Worse, it may facilitate remote hackers to arrive at your machine and steal your confidential information such as all kinds of bank details to make some illegal profits silently. Trojan.Backdoor-JCK performs like a time-bomb that can maximize the damages onto a compromised machine. Beyond all questions, you’ll have to find out all files and registries created by Trojan.Backdoor-JCK and delete them in time to protect your PC properties and individual privacy.

Step one: Terminate the processes of the Trojan in Windows Task Manager.
1) Right-click on the taskbar (or press CTRL+SHIFT+ESC keys) to open Windows Task Manager.
2) Click on the Processes tab, scroll down and find out its running processes of the Trojan, and then click on “End Process” button to terminate the selected processes.

Windows XP, Windows Vista, and Windows 7

Go to Start Menu, then under ‘Run’ or ‘Search Program and Files’ field, type rstrui.
Then, press Enter on the keyboard to open System Restore Settings.

Windows 8 and Windows 10

Hover your mouse cursor to the lower left corner of the screen and wait for the Start icon to appear.
Right-click on the icon and select Run from the list. This will open a Run dialog box.
Type rstrui on the ‘Open’ field and click on OK to initiate the command.

Next,
1.Continue on the steps and choose a desired restore point. All saved restore points are listed with corresponding date, time and description. Please click and read ‘How do I choose a restore point?’ for additional guide. system-restore-7
Typically, only the most recent restore points are shown.

system-restore-7

If prompted to Confirm your restore point, please click on Finish to begin the process.
Note, System Restore will not bring back lost personal files such as documents, images and videos. System Restore specific purpose is to bring back previous configuration and change the system state of Windows.
